Optical bistability in a laser containing a saturable absorber
Laboratory of the Photonic Systems and Nonlinear Optics, Dept of Optics and Precision Mechanics, University Ferhat Abbas-Setif, Algeria
Corresponding author: s_djabi@yahoo.fr
In this work, the theory of optical bistability for the homogeneously broadening of a nonlinear absorber inside Fabry-Perot interferometer is treated. The theoretical influence of the resonator losses on the optical bistability is examined mainly in the cases for which losses depend on both the mode frequency and the density of photons. On the basis of the Rate Equation Approach (REA), we analytically and numerically solved this type of equation for stationary case.
